This scenario is based on the encoding of the different rotations in one or more 2D instance(s), which can be encoded either as X-Ray Angiography or Enhanced XA Images.
In the case of multiple source 2D Instances, the acquisition equipment assumes that the patient has not moved between the different rotations. This module encodes the same FoR UID in all the rotations, identifying a common spatial relationship between them, thus allowing the 3D reconstruction to use the projections of all the rotations to perform a single volume reconstruction.
If the source 2D Instances do not provide a value of FoR UID, it has to be created for the reconstructed volume.

The case where all the source 2D Instances have the same FoR UID is the "lucky" case. If no FoR UID value is provided in the 2D Instances, or if the FoR UIDs are different, there should be an additional 2D registration step before performing the 3D reconstruction.
